Tools and Materials Needed


Performing cabinet resurfacing requires more than just glue and new fronts—you’ll need industrial tools like edge banders, clamps, orbital sanders, and contact cement rollers. For hardwood cabinet refacing or wood veneer refacing, you may also need veneer saws and moisture meters. Most homeowners don’t own these, making rental or purchase another my link hit to their kitchen remodeling cost.

In contrast, professional cabinet refacing teams arrive fully equipped. They use high-performance gear to ensure clean seams, perfect alignment, and durable cabinet finishes that last.

Avoiding Moisture Damage


Steam is the #1 enemy of refaced cabinetry, especially near sinks and dishwashers. Even with durable cabinet finishes, prolonged exposure can cause swelling. To protect your Sammamish cabinet remodeling investment, ensure proper ventilation and promptly fix leaks. Installing a backsplash and using cabinet liners adds extra protection.

For kitchens with high humidity, consider hardwood cabinet refacing with sealed edges or thermofoil options known for water resistance. These choices stand up better to steam and splashes than basic paint or low-grade laminate.
